NOTICE OF INTENT TO SOLE SOURCE In support of Project No: CDRH-2024-124786 & CDRH-2024-124211 The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), Office of Acquisitions and Grant Services, Facilities Support Branch intends to award a firm fixed price purchase order to Waters Technologies Corporation (Waters), Milford, Massachusetts, 01757-3604 for the repair and preventative maintenance service of one (1) Waters Gel permeation Chromatography (GPC) System.
The order will include a 12-month base period and two 12-month options. Waters is the original equipment manufacturer (OEM) and the only source with factory trained and certified technicians capable of repairing and servicing the FDA GPC System. Waters is also the only source with direct access to the required OEM parts, instrument and propriety software for factory directed updates and upgrades, and access to global and expert service technicians to resolve instrument related issues.
This procurement is being conducted in accordance with FAR subpart 13.106-1(b)(1)(i) which allows the Contracting Officer to solicit from one source. The North American Classification System Code is 811210, Other Electronic and Precision Equipment Repair and Maintenance and Product Service Code, J066 – Maintenance/Repair/Rebuild of Equipment – Instruments and Laboratory Equipment. This notice is being distributed solely via the System for Awards Management website (www.SAM.gov) .
As Waters is the only source that can meet the Government’s need at this time, this notice is not a request for competitive quotes.
